Big Things on the Beach: The Italian Job

Public Art Fest

27 August – 3 September 2011

Toxme:  video and canvasses by Federico Calo

OmbraMalombra: interactive performance with live video by Ezia Mitolo

ChristinMeby Magda Milano: video installation, canvasses and floral sculptures

The Big Welcome: Tablecloths from the community of Portobello

 

Part of Big Things on the Beach's Public Art Fest, a week long, free programme of participatory public art projects, workshops and discussions,  developed in collaboration with the Edinburgh College of Art and with GeoArte, an international cultural exchange organisation based in Puglia, southern Italy.
